The Psychology of Value Perception
The instances where individuals repurpose discarded items into something new highlight the complexities of value perception. Research conducted by Dr. Richard Thaler, a Nobel laureate in economic sciences, underscores how people's perceptions of value can vary dramatically based on context and personal experiences.
This phenomenon, often referred to as the 'endowment effect,' explains why individuals may attach greater value to items they own compared to similar items they do not possess. Understanding this psychological principle can provide insight into why some people see potential in what others deem worthless.
